Etymology

edit

From āltepētl (city-state) +‎ -huah (possessor of).

Pronunciation

edit
  • IPA(key): /ˌaːwaʔteˈpeːwaʔ/

Noun

edit

āhuah tepēhuah (plural āhuahqueh tepēhuahqueh)

  1. (he or she is) one who possesses or lives in an altepetl or a city.
